My question is how often do airlines amend their flight timetables? Is there a standard time of year this is done, or is it something they monitor and change when required. I am primarily interested in Singapore Air and Qantas.

Normally twice a year, during the Northen Summer and Northen Winter, but then again most flight times do stay around the same.
 
For Qantas it's generally around the beginning and end of Daylight saving; occasionally some major updates on June 30th and perhaps Dec 1.
